Experience Rimsky-Korsakov's Enduring Genius Live
Nikolai Rimsky-Korsakov, a luminary of the "Mighty Handful" – a group of 19th-century Russian composers who sought to create a distinctively Russian classical music – left an indelible mark on the world of classical music with his vibrant orchestrations and captivating narratives. Though the composer himself is long departed, his spirit lives on through the power of live performance, and Fort Lauderdale is set to be captivated. Audiences attending Rimsky-Korsakov at Lillian S. Wells Hall will likely be treated to a selection of his most iconic works, perhaps including excerpts from the Arabian Nights-inspired "Scheherazade," with its mesmerizing melodies and exotic textures, or the instantly recognizable, virtuosic "Flight of the Bumblebee." His compositions are celebrated for their colorful instrumentation, programmatic depth, and ability to transport listeners to fantastical realms. Lillian S. Wells Hall: Fort Lauderdale's Premier Cultural Gem
Lillian S. Wells Hall at The Parker stands as a beacon of arts and culture in Fort Lauderdale, FL. Originally opened in 1967 as The Parker Playhouse, this venue underwent a magnificent transformation, reopening in 2021 as a state-of-the-art facility while retaining its beloved mid-century modern charm.
